The Congregation Missionaries of Faith was founded in Italy by Anna Maria Andreani and Fr. Luigi Duilio Graziotti and erected canonically on December 25th 1982.

The main aim of the Congregation is to be at the service of the Church and to proclaim the love of God to all and to reach the perfection of Charity through the personal sanctification in fidelity to the Spirit proper of the Institute.

The main Charism of the Congregation is to undertake any kind of Apostolic Missionary Activity at the request of the ecclesiastical Authorities, Specially where the priestly Missionary is most needed. Special attention is given to activities for the benefit of the priests, for leading them to holiness of the proper vocation and to be of support and fraternal help to them. Our Charism can in short be defined as Faith and Mission.

 

The other Charisms are apostolate towards the separated brethren for bringing them to the Catholic Faith and apostolate towards the youth for promoting the development of their proper vocation.

The Motto of the Congregation is Gratia et Gaudium in Fide that isGrace and Joy in Faith.

The Titular of the Congregation is The HOLY TRINITY. Our patron is Mary Queen of Confessors.
